Series "Look me in the eyes" of 8 separate portraits of prominent rock musicians. Each portrait of eight is a separate canvas that can be exhibited separately. The series “Look into my eyes” represented Ukraine at the 6th Beijing International Art Biennale in 2015. (BIAB-China-2015 - " Memory and Dreams ") Outstanding personalities, great musicians who have done a lot for music, art and very early gone into the world different. The 6 Beijing International Art of Bienniale - 2015 (BIAB-China-2015 - " Memory and Dreams ") Look in my eyes.
